During last night's RTHS board meeting, several assistant coaches were approved for the winter sports season.
Rich Harvey will be an assistant coach in wrestling with Olivia Caron, a graduate of RTHS, will be an assistant coach in the girls basketball program.
Kim Wagner was also named volunteer Swim Coach. This will enable any student-athlete the chance to participate in the state competition as an individual. RTHS does not have a swim team.
The RTHS Girls Tennis program held their annual banquet last night as several awards were handed out.
The Varsity High Point Award went to Haley Griffith and Lisa Noggle. The girls have qualified for the State Tennis Tournament in the doubles competition this Thursday in the Mt. Prospect area.
The most improved player on the varsity was Shelby Mickey.
The High Point Award on the Frosh-Soph team was Elora Berg. The most improved player was Mercedes Castro.
